Dreamland-梦境网

   [登录]    [注册]
坏菠萝
2019-03-15 13:50:13

更新支持markdown语法

描述信息

二、代码区域

public class OpenUserDetailsService implements UserDetailsService {

@Autowired
private OpenUserService openUserService;
@Autowired
private UserService userService;
@Autowired
private RoleService roleService;

public UserDetails loadUserByUsername(String openId) throws OpenUserNotFoundException {
    OpenUser openUser = openUserService.findByOpenId( openId);
    if(openUser == null){
        throw new OpenUserNotFoundException("第三方用户openId不存在");
    }
    User user = userService.findById( openUser.getuId() );//修改直接根据用户id查询
    List<Role> roles = roleService.findByUid( user.getId() );
    user.setRoles( roles );
    openUser.setUser( user );
    return openUser;
}
}

我的CSDN博客地址

1 · 5 评论

 
光光不光
2019-03-14 09:30:21

从tale过来

之前用tale作为架构,加上自己小改,用腾讯1G的小水管搭了一个博客.但是tale用的blade封装,很是精小,我想把这个ssm博客改成springboot,再加上自学一点前端,应该能带来不一样的感受

  • 测试md
  • 顺带测试md语法是否合格
  1. 标题
  2. 22
0 · 0 评论

 
123
2019-03-04 20:41:20

上传图片

java框架集合
图片1

2 · 0 评论

 
123
2019-03-04 20:08:57

世界的梦,我的梦

你好,世界!

2 · 0 评论

 
KISS
2019-03-04 10:53:00

再来一次!

路人阿甲你好啊!

这课程终于肝完了,学到很多东西,感谢老师课程中的耐心讲解

3 · 3 评论

 
囚徒。
2019-03-03 16:18:45

秘籍

说什么好,给你一本秘籍

2 · 1 评论

 
KISS
2019-02-27 09:45:25

来啦来啦

4 · 13 评论

 


互联网ICP备案:皖ICP备18007469号

违法和不良信息举报电话:010-xxxxxxx 邮箱:dreamland_wang@163.com

©www.dreamland.wang 梦境网版权所有

广告

SSM 博客系统开发实战

  • SSM 博客系统开发实战
  • 王林永·Java 高级工程师,CSDN博客专栏.
  • ¥29.99 | 20 课
  • 最新
    架构
    SSM
    Java

  • 导读:为什么选择 SSM 框架开发项目
  • 第01课:基础环境安装及Maven创建父子工程
  • 第02课:SSM 框架的搭建
  • 第03课:MySQL表设计及反向生成实体类
  • 第04课:接口设计及通用 Mapper
  • 第05课:注册(邮件激活、Ajax 异步获取)
  • 第06课:登录之账号登录(验证码)
  • 第07课:登录之手机快捷登录
  • 第08课:首页展示及分页(PageHelper)
  • 第09课:评论、回复及点赞模块
  • 第10课:个人主页模块
  • 第11课:博客书写页面——KindEditor
  • 第12课:个人资料修改页面
  • 第13课:第三方 QQ 登录及账号绑定与解除
  • 第14课:首页搜索功能(Solr)
  • 第15课:Spring-Security 源码解读及认证授权
  • 第16课:Spring-Security 之手机登录认证授权
  • 第17课:Spring-Security 之QQ登录认证授权
  • 第18课:Linux 系统部署发布
  • 第19课:项目总结